Disappointed by Lack of Flexibility During Financial HardshipI joined Wollit in June 2023 to build my credit and made 23 on-time payments, which helped my score. However, in August 2025, I missed one payment due to severe cost-of-living pressures (rising bills and reduced income), forcing me to cancel direct debits to cover essentials. Wollit reported this to Experian, Equifax, and TransUnion, impacting my credit file.I contacted support to explain my situation and request a goodwill removal, given my strong payment history and the one-off nature of the miss. Their response on September 18, 2025 was polite but unhelpful, stating they couldn’t remove the mark or allow payment as the account was closed. This felt inflexible, especially for a service meant to support credit-building during tough times. The mark could affect my [e.g., mortgage application] for up to 6 years.While Wollit’s app and reporting were useful, I’m disappointed they didn’t consider my circumstances. A goodwill gesture or hardship policy could’ve made a difference. I hope they adopt more customer-focused practices for others in similar situations.Nico K
